Vertiv Reports Strong Third Quarter Results including Organic Orders +60%, Diluted EPS +122% (Adjusted EPS +63%); Raises 2025 Guidance
Prnewswire· 2025-10-22 09:55
Core Insights - Vertiv Holdings Co reported a strong financial performance for Q3 2025, with net sales reaching $2,676 million, a 29% increase year-over-year, driven by significant growth in the Americas and APAC regions [1][10] - The company experienced a substantial increase in organic orders, up approximately 60% year-over-year and 20% sequentially from Q2 2025, indicating robust market demand [1][10] - Vertiv's adjusted operating profit for Q3 2025 was $596 million, reflecting a 43% increase compared to the same quarter in 2024, with an adjusted operating margin of 22.3% [2][10] Financial Performance - Q3 2025 net sales were $2,676 million, up $602 million or 29% from Q3 2024, with the Americas growing by 43% and APAC by 20% [1][10] - Operating profit for Q3 2025 was $517 million, a 39% increase from the previous year, while adjusted operating profit rose to $596 million, a 43% increase [2][10] - Adjusted diluted EPS for Q3 2025 was $1.24, up 63% from Q3 2024 [10] Cash Flow and Liquidity - Net cash generated by operating activities in Q3 2025 was $509 million, with adjusted free cash flow increasing by 38% to $462 million [4][10] - Liquidity remained strong at $2.7 billion, with net leverage at approximately 0.5x at the end of Q3 2025 [5] Guidance and Future Outlook - Vertiv raised its full-year 2025 guidance, increasing adjusted diluted EPS from $3.80 to $4.10 and adjusted operating profit from $1,990 million to $2,060 million [7][10] - The company anticipates continued strong growth, with Q4 2025 net sales expected to be between $2,810 million and $2,890 million, reflecting organic net sales growth of 18% to 22% [7][10] Strategic Initiatives - Vertiv is investing in expanding manufacturing and services capacity to meet rising industry demand, particularly in AI-driven infrastructure [3][6] - The company is also enhancing its engineering, research, and development capabilities to stay ahead of industry trends [3][6]

Buy, Sell or Hold Vertiv Stock? Key Tips Ahead of Q3 Earnings
ZACKS· 2025-10-20 14:10
Core Insights - Vertiv (VRT) is expected to report third-quarter 2025 results on October 22, with revenues projected between $2.51 billion and $2.59 billion, indicating a year-over-year growth of 24.6% [1][2] - The consensus estimate for earnings is $1 per share, reflecting a 31.6% year-over-year increase [2] Financial Performance - The Zacks Consensus Estimate for third-quarter 2025 revenues is $2.58 billion, with earnings expected at $1 per share, which has increased by a penny over the past 30 days [2] - Vertiv's earnings have consistently beaten the Zacks Consensus Estimate in the last four quarters, with an average earnings surprise of 10.65% [6] Growth Drivers - The anticipated growth in Q3 results is attributed to Vertiv's extensive product portfolio, including thermal systems, liquid cooling, UPS, and modular solutions, particularly benefiting from AI-driven order growth [8] - Recent acquisitions, such as Waylay NV and Great Lakes Data Racks & Cabinets, are expected to enhance Vertiv's capabilities in AI-driven monitoring and control technologies, contributing to top-line growth [10][12] Market Position - Vertiv shares have gained 53.2% year-to-date, outperforming the Zacks Computer & Technology sector's growth of 23.1% and the Zacks Computer IT Services industry's decline of 16.4% [13] - The stock is currently trading above its 50-day and 200-day moving averages, indicating a bullish trend [16] Valuation Concerns - Despite strong performance, Vertiv's stock is considered overvalued, with a Value Score of D and a 12-month price/book ratio of 21.26, significantly higher than the sector average of 11.29 [19] - The company faces challenges in the EMEA region, with flat sales expected for 2025 compared to 2024, alongside rising expenses related to engineering and R&D [23] Competitive Landscape - Vertiv is experiencing rapid growth in the liquid cooling market, crucial for AI and high-density computing, but faces intense competition in this area [25] - Concerns over tariff headwinds and stretched valuation are noted as potential risks for investors [25]
中国数据中心设备:英伟达发布 800VDC 架构白皮书-China Data Center Equipment_ NVIDIA released white paper for 800VDC architecture
2025-10-19 15:58
Summary of Key Points from the Conference Call Industry Overview - **Industry**: Data Center Equipment in China - **Key Company**: NVIDIA Core Insights and Arguments - **Transition to 800VDC Architecture**: NVIDIA released a white paper detailing the transition to an 800VDC power distribution model for AI infrastructure, confirming a phased approach to this transition [2][4] - **Phase 1**: Retrofit with an 800VDC side rack to convert from 480VAC to 800VDC - **Phase 2**: Replace UPS with high power density rectifiers - **Phase 3**: Utilize Medium Voltage rectifiers or Solid State Transformers (SST) for direct conversion from medium voltage to 800VDC - **Energy Storage as Essential Component**: Energy storage is highlighted as a critical part of the 800VDC architecture, addressing load swings and enhancing compatibility with DC environments [4] - **Short Duration Storage**: High power capacitors and super capacitors for high frequency power volatility - **Long Duration Storage**: Located at grid interconnections for managing larger power shifts - **Commercialization Timeline**: Anticipated delivery of HVDC systems starting from the second half of 2026, with mass production scaling from 2027 and SST commercialization ramping up from 2029 [2] Key Suppliers and Partnerships - **NVIDIA's Ecosystem**: Key industry partners aiding the development of the 800VDC system include major power system component providers and data center power system providers such as ABB, Eaton, and Siemens [3] Investment Insights - **Top Pick**: Kehua Data is identified as a top pick within the Chinese AIDC supply chain due to its potential for overseas HVDC market penetration and technological advantages [5] - **Valuation Risks**: Major downside risks for the data center equipment sector include slower-than-expected AI data center capacity growth and market share gains in overseas AIDC equipment supply chain [10][11] Valuation Methodology - **Price Target for Kehua**: Based on a DCF methodology, with potential risks including slower IDC capacity expansion and lower-than-expected overseas shipments of energy storage systems [11][23] Additional Considerations - **Market Dynamics**: The report emphasizes the importance of energy storage in the evolving data center landscape, driven by increasing capital expenditures in the sector [4] - **Analyst Contact Information**: Analysts involved in the report include Yishu Yan, Ken Liu, and Anna Yuan, providing insights into the sector [6] This summary encapsulates the critical points discussed in the conference call, focusing on the transition to 800VDC architecture, the role of energy storage, key partnerships, and investment insights regarding Kehua Data.

Link: Vertiv is a data center buildout play with 50% CapEx growth ahead
CNBC Television· 2025-10-17 11:18
Growth & Financial Performance - Verdive's capital expenditure is expected to grow approximately 50% between 2025 and 2029 [1] - The company is likely to achieve 15% to 20% organic growth [1][5] - Verdive has a backlog of $85 billion and a book-to-bill ratio of 12 times [1] - Record orders of $32 billion, a 25% year-over-year increase, were recorded last quarter [2] - The company targets a 25% operating margin by 2028 [2] - Earnings power could reach $7 to $10 [3] Valuation & Competitive Landscape - Verdive's valuation is higher compared to peers like Johnson Controls and Eaton [4] - Verdive has faster growth and greater margin expansion potential compared to competitors [5][6] Management & Risks - The company has best-in-class management, including Executive Chairman David Cody (former Honeywell CEO) [6][7] - David Cody's involvement in other ventures and potential executive poaching are concerns [8][9] - The company has a new CFO focused on margins and productivity [10] - The stock's performance is heavily linked to the AI data center trend, posing a risk if the AI trade cools down [10][11] Market Dynamics - The AI data center story will directly impact the stock's trading [10] - There are 11400 data centers worldwide, with the US accounting for 5400 (45%) [11] - The industry needs to reach 30000 data centers to meet demand [11]
